"Researching Breslau's Jewish Community Through Data-Mining," Stephen Falk

 

Stephen Falk, president of the Jewish Genealogical Society of British Columbia, will discuss expanding records for the Jewish community in the former eastern Germany city of Breslau, now Wroclaw, Poland. His focus has been searching all available 18th and 19th century records and linking most of the Jewish families of Breslau from that time.

 

Stephen, who lives in Point Roberts, Washington on the U.S./Canadian border, has devoted 45 years to researching his family lines from Silesia, Posen and West and East Prussia.
